Rosemead sits in the San Gabriel Valley thermal basin, about 12 miles inland from the coast. Summer afternoons regularly push past 95 degrees, and the UV load does things to aluminum frames and vinyl weatherstripping that homeowners in Santa Monica never have to think about. That matters when you’re choosing glass packages and frame materials. We’ll talk through what makes sense for your specific house on your specific street, not a generic “good-better-best” pitch.

Our Window Installation Services in Rosemead

Sliding Windows

Sliding windows are everywhere in Rosemead, and on the San Gabriel Valley’s expansive clay soils, the original wood-framed openings have shifted over decades. Put a new slider into an out-of-square jamb and you’ll bind the track, break the weatherstripping seal, and be back in a year asking why the glass fogs. We reframe when we need to before we set the window, which is the difference between a slider that opens with one finger and one that takes two hands. A typical slider replacement in Rosemead runs $500-$1,400 per opening.

Casement Windows

Casement windows are a good fit for Rosemead’s single-story ranch homes, especially where you want to catch the evening breeze. They seal tighter than sliders because the sash cranks into gaskets on all four sides. In Rosemead, where summer heat and winter Santa Ana winds test every seal, that matters. Expect to pay $600-$1,600 per casement opening, depending on glass package and whether we’re retrofitting into an existing frame or doing a full-frame replacement.

Fixed & Picture Windows

Rosemead has a significant number of homes with large street-facing picture windows, many original to the 1950s and 1960s. These are the windows that bake the living room in the afternoon and drive cooling bills up. Low-E dual-pane replacement with a quality frame changes the indoor temperature in a way you can feel the same week. Fixed window installation in Rosemead typically runs $400-$1,100 per opening, with larger panoramic units going higher based on glass area and structural requirements.

Awning Windows

Awning windows work well in Rosemead kitchens and bathrooms where wall space is tight and ventilation matters. They hinge at the top and open outward, which lets you vent on a warm afternoon without giving up your privacy. We see a lot of homeowners pair awning windows with sliders or casements to get light and airflow into a corner that a larger sash won’t fit. Plan on $450-$1,200 per awning opening in Rosemead.

Window Installation and LA County Permitting: What Rosemead Homeowners Need to Know

Here is the thing most window companies will not tell you until you’re already into the job: Rosemead is unincorporated LA County, so all window permit reviews go through LA County Building & Safety, not a city hall. That means any replacement window must meet current Title 24 energy standards. Inspectors here routinely reject clear single-pane like-for-like swaps that would pass in nearby incorporated cities like San Gabriel or Temple City. We have watched other contractors get to inspection day with a clear-glass slider and get sent back to the drawing board. The homeowner eats the tear-out and the reorder.

On a 1958 ranch on Graves Avenue with original aluminum sliders, our crew found the jambs had sagged nearly 3/8 inch out of square from the expansive clay soil. We reframed the rough openings, installed Milgard Tuscany vinyl sliders with argon-filled Low-E insulated glass units, and replaced the rotted sills before flashing tape and trim, then scheduled the LA County inspection that passed on the first visit. If someone tells you they can “just swap the glass” without pulling a permit in Rosemead, be careful. That approach fails more often than it passes, and you are the one left holding the bill.

Title 24 also means the glass package you choose is not just a comfort decision. It is a compliance decision. Low-E dual-pane is the baseline in Rosemead for any permitted replacement, and in a thermal basin that routinely hits 100 degrees in August, that is a good thing. The same standard that keeps the inspector happy is the one that drops your cooling load and keeps the afternoon sun from turning your living room into a kiln.

Common Window Installation Problems We See in Rosemead Homes

  • Out-of-square rough openings from clay soil movement. The San Gabriel Valley’s expansive clay expands and contracts with moisture, and 60-year-old wood framing does not stay square. Putting a new double-hung into a shifted opening creates a bound sash and a failed seal within the first year. We check, and we reframe when we need to.
  • Clear single-pane “like-for-like” swaps that fail LA County inspection. A contractor pulls a permit, installs clear single-pane sliders to match the 1960s originals, and the inspector rejects them for failing Title 24 fenestration requirements. The homeowner pays for a tear-out and a reorder. Happens more than you would think.
  • Skipped impact-rated glazing on rear sliders. A homeowner replaces street-facing windows with Low-E glass but skips impact-rated glazing on the rear slider. The first summer UV and heat cycle warps the vinyl frame enough to break the weatherstripping seal. In Rosemead’s heat, UV exposure is not a slow burn. It works fast.
  • Rotted sills hidden under old trim. The 1950s-1970s single-story homes in Rosemead often have windows with wood sills that have been quietly rotting for two decades. It only shows once the old window is out and the trim is off. We replace the sill before we set the new window, which is why our quotes account for what we find, not just what you see.

Pricing for Window Installation in Rosemead, CA

Window installation in Rosemead runs $450-$1,200 per opening for a standard retrofit on a single-pane original, and $900-$2,800 per opening for full-frame replacement with new jambs, sill, flashing tape, and exterior trim. Casement windows land around $600-$1,600 each. Sliders run $500-$1,400. Fixed and picture windows start near $400 and climb based on glass area. These are per-opening ranges for Low-E dual-pane glass that will meet Title 24. If you are replacing all the windows in a 1,600-square-foot Rosemead ranch, plan on $8,000-$20,000 all in, depending on window count, frame material, glass package, and what we find when the old trim comes off. Full-frame work costs more because we’re rebuilding the opening, not sliding a window into a hole that has shifted out of square over 60 years.
